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Etape 2 Carte - Localisation du pointeur sur la carte #14

Closed
Chrispnv opened this issue Nov 5, 2019 · 12 comments
Closed

Etape 2 Carte - Localisation du pointeur sur la carte #14

Chrispnv opened this issue Nov 5, 2019 · 12 comments
Labels
enhancement New feature or request question Further information is requested

Comments

@Chrispnv
Copy link

Chrispnv commented Nov 5, 2019

A clic sur carte le pointeur ne se localise pas où on a cliqué mais au centre de la carte. Il faut le déplacer pour le localiser au bon endroit.
Attendu : Le pointeur s'affiche là où on a cliqué sur la carte.

@sgrimault
Copy link
Collaborator

Le comportement actuel est que le bouton "+" ajoute directement le marqueur automatiquement centré sur la carte. Il faut ensuite le sélectionner de nouveau pour le déplacer à l'endroit souhaité en faisant un toucher long. Si on se déplace ainsi pendant la sélection, la carte va suivre automatiquement le mouvement de l'utilisateur pour accompagner le déplacement. L'avantage est que l'on peut placer rapidement un marqueur avec peu d'interactions (aucune étape intermédiaire), contrairement aux comportements possibles suivants :

L'autre comportement possible serait de passer par une étape intermédiaire lors du "clic" sur le bouton "+" et laisser l'utilisateur de placer le marqueur en "cliquant" sur la carte avec un message explicatif. Je ne suis pas sur si c'est plus simple ou plus intuitif pour l'utilisateur car le "clic" sur la carte restera de toute manière peu précis au final et il faudra du coup sélectionner à nouveau le marqueur pour le positionner à nouveau. On revient du coup à ce qui existe déjà.

Un autre comportement possible serait d'afficher un marqueur "fantôme" (semi transparent) automatiquement centré sur la carte lors du "clic" sur le bouton "+". Un message explicatif devra être affiché pour expliquer à l'utilisateur qu'il peut positionner le marqueur final en se déplaçant sur la carte ; le marqueur "fantôme" jouant alors d'aide à la saisie. Le message explicatif serait accompagné des boutons "OK" / "Valider" pour terminer la saisie, ou de l'abandonner. Ce même principe pourrait être utilisé lors de l'édition où on verrait deux marqueurs sur la carte : Le marqueur existant déjà positionné, le marqueur "fantôme" d'aide à la saisie pour fixer la nouvelle position. L'avantage est que l'on aura une saisie plus précise. L'inconvénient est que l'on rentre dans un workflow de saisie plus compliqué.

@ClaireLagaye ClaireLagaye changed the title OccTax 0.1.9 - Etape 2 Carte - Localisation du pointeur sur la carte Etape 2 Carte - Localisation du pointeur sur la carte Jan 7, 2020
@ClaireLagaye
Copy link

Test de la version 0.2.5
Le marqueur se met au centre de la carte mais l'édition est simple et intuitive je trouve

@DonovanMaillard
Copy link
Collaborator

Bonjour,

Pour avoir testé aussi l'application, c'est peu intuitif je trouve. Je m'attendais comme christophe a un appui long qui positionnerait d'office un pointage, sans avoir à appuyer sur le + puis placer le marqueur ensuite.

Là pour le pointage, ca oblige à faire 2 étapes, d'abord créer un pointage, ensuite le placer... ca double les actions nécessaires et fait perdre du temps lors de la saisie à mon sens.

@camillemonchicourt camillemonchicourt added enhancement New feature or request question Further information is requested labels May 18, 2020
@DonovanMaillard
Copy link
Collaborator

Quelques versions, mois et saisies plus tard, le retour utilisateur reste le même de mon coté et pour mon collègue. Tout en conservant le fonctionnement actuel, on aimerait qu'un appui long crée le pointage sur la carte ou déplace le pointage existant, sans avoir à créer un point pour le déplacer et le positionner précisément.

Est-ce que vous avez d'autres retours utilisateurs sur cette étape désormais ?

@DonovanMaillard
Copy link
Collaborator

Envisagé dans une révision ergonomique plus large dans le cadre du projet AAP SINP

@cen-cgeier
Copy link

cen-cgeier commented Feb 24, 2022

Bonjour à tous,

J'ai installé Occtax-mobile en test, avant de le déployer plus largement et de le rendre utilisable par les collègues au printemps.
Config du mobile : Samsung galaxy Note 9, Andoid 10
Version d'Occtax-mobile : 1.3.0
Je sais qu'une V2 est en cours, et globalement je fais les mêmes constats que @DonovanMaillard.

J'ajouterais qu'il n'est pas possible de mon côté de supprimer un marqueur, une fois positionné.
Rester appuyé sur le pointeur permet de le basculer en mode édition et de faire apparaître une poubelle en haut à droite. Sauf que relâcher le pointeur pour appuyer sur la poubelle désactive l'édition. La suppression devient alors impossible. J'ai testé de faire glisser le pointeur jusqu'à la poubelle (comme les désinstallations d'appli android), ça déplace le pointeur mais ne le supprime pas. Appuyer à la fois sur le pointeur et sur la poubelle ne fonctionne pas non plus. La seule solution que j'ai trouvé reste de "sortir" du relevé, le supprimer et d'en réaliser un autre.

@sgrimault
Copy link
Collaborator

sgrimault commented Feb 24, 2022

Bonjour @cen-cgeier,

Juste pour clarifier et expliquer le fonctionnement actuel :

  • L'utilisateur zoom suffisamment sur la carte pour que le bouton d'ajout d'un marqueur apparaisse. Cette contrainte est pilotée coté paramétrage de l'application où on peut fixer le zoom minimal requis pour poser un marqueur.
  • L'utilisateur "tape" sur le bouton d'ajout pour poser un marqueur centrée sur la carte pour le niveau de zoom actuel. Le bouton d'ajout disparait alors car on n'autorise qu'un seul marqueur de position pour un relevé.
  • Ensuite, l'utilisateur sélectionne le marqueur en faisant un toucher long dessus pour pouvoir le sélectionner et le déplacer à l'endroit voulu. Dès que l'utilisateur "relâche" le marqueur, celui-ci garde sa dernière position.
  • L'utilisateur peut aussi sélectionner le marqueur en faisant juste un tape simple. On voit alors apparaitre une barre d'action contextuelle au marqueur de couleur foncée par dessus la barre d'action de la carte dans lequel on va retrouver le bouton "poubelle" qui permet de le supprimer. En supprimant le marqueur et si le zoom actuel permet d'en ajouter un, le bouton d'ajout d'un marqueur réapparait.

@gildeluermoz
Copy link

Je confirme que la suppression du marqueur fonctionne avec un tape simple sur le marqueur comme décrit par @sgrimault
Android 8, galaxy S7 Occtax_mobile V1.3.1

@cen-cgeier
Copy link

cen-cgeier commented Feb 24, 2022

Autant pour moi, j'avais pas la notion de la "tape simple" sur le marqueur pour le basculer en mode édition..
Effectivement, la suppression du marqueur fonctionne très bien maintenant que je le sais.
Merci @sgrimault !

Ce qui a suscité une confusion chez moi est que la barre d'action contextuelle apparaît également lors d'un toucher long.

@camillemonchicourt
Copy link
Member

Je relance ce sujet car on a souvent des retours sur la localisation du relevé dans Occtax-mobile.
Un retour d'aujourd'hui :

le pointage est moins bon qu'avant : il suffisait de taper ou on voulait pour déplacer le pointeur. Maintenant il faut le sélectionner (il devient bleu) et on le bouge : mais on ne voit pas bien la carte sous son doigt et quand il fait froid c'est pas top.

@DonovanMaillard
Copy link
Collaborator

Oui Camille, même retour de notre coté, il faudrait revenir au fonctionnement précédent sur ce point...

sgrimault added a commit to PnX-SI/gn_mobile_maps that referenced this issue Jun 20, 2022
sgrimault added a commit to PnX-SI/gn_mobile_maps that referenced this issue Jun 22, 2022
sgrimault added a commit that referenced this issue Jun 22, 2022
sgrimault added a commit to PnX-SI/gn_mobile_maps that referenced this issue Jun 29, 2022
@DonovanMaillard
Copy link
Collaborator

Le comportement de positionner ou repositionner le point par un appui long a été mis en place dans la version 2.3.0 d'Occtax-mobile.

Pour les plus anciens utilisateurs de GeoNature, on retrouve donc le comportement des anciennes applications mobiles de GeoNature V1

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request question Further information is requested
Projects
Development

No branches or pull requests

7 participants